## Changelog — 2.9.0: New Reconnect Defaults

Heads up: the Brindlecast websocket client used to retry instantly and forever, which hammered the gateway whenever Oakmere region blipped. We've switched to exponential backoff with jitter and a cap of eight attempts before surfacing an error to the UI. Most tenants won't notice anything except fewer thundering herds. The new default values ship as follows.

config for bagep-kageg:
ULADOR_LOG_LEVEL=warn
ULADOR_METRICS_HOST=metrics.ulador.tolvaqcorp.corp
ULADOR_POOL_SIZE=32

### Step 4: Fix timezone handling in report exports

Quick heads-up before you touch the Bramblewick export jobs: the old system stamped everything in server-local time, which drifted whenever the Kelton box got rebuilt. The new exporter converts everything to UTC at write time and lets the report viewer localize. Don't hand-convert anything in SQL — that's what bit the last contractor. Once you've swapped the exporter module, update the job settings to match the values shown below.

deployment values, yadug-bawif:
[framir]
team = pelox
access_code = ac_a38ab2
owner = tamion.julael
host = framir.tolvaqlabs.test
port = 11211
peer = tammir.zemvargrid.local
salt = 2215ef03
pin = 1541

## Deploying LedgerLoom after the export format change

Future maintainer, hello. As of v4, LedgerLoom emits payroll exports in the new columnar format that Bramblewick Payroll requires; the old flat-file writer is gone, so don't try to re-enable it. Deploys are straightforward: build, run the schema check, ship. One gotcha — the exporter reads its settings at startup only, so a config change means a restart, not a reload. Before your first deploy, set the configuration values listed below.

settings of bagag-hafop:
ZORWYN_HOST=zorwyn.tolvaqsys.internal
ZORWYN_PORT=8000